![]() ![]() Hi, everybody. I'm Mickey Loomis, general manager of the New Orleans Saints, and I'm here to announce the New Orleans Saints' first pick of the 2008 RedsZone NFL Mock Draft. As a team, we would be very intersted in getting an impact center or tight end in the draft, but I don't see one available who would justify the 10th overall pick. With that said, based on our needs, we decided to focus on defense for this pick. Ideally, we'd improve at cornerback, linebacker, or defensive tackle. Seeing as how Glenn Dorsey and Sedrick Ellis are already gone, we will wait to address that particular need. Keith Rivers might have been our next pick, but with the recent acquisition of Jonathan Vilma, we are not going to sweat it too much. Thus, through the process of elimination, we will most definitely be choosing a cornerback. We are very intrigued by Aqib Talib. His size is obviously impressive, and his name just sounds really cool. We happen to like Mike Jenkins, too, but there are some character questions there. We feel that Leodis McKelvin is just as good Jenkins, is a bit more polished, and has more to offer on special teams, hence:

Re: OFFICIAL 2008 nfl Redzone Draft.
Whoa! Back to back surprise picks.
First of all, I LOVE Heather's pick of Brohm for Carolina. Any QB is always a risk, but the Panthers really need a young QB to groom and I think Brohm is going to be a good one. I also think Carolina is in a pretty good situation for him to enter into. BuckeyeRedleg??? I'm not destroying the selection by any means, because Chicago certainly needs some playmakers, but my general philosophy is that RB is an overrated position in the NFL UNLESS you have an elite back like Adrian Peterson. I'm not sure Mendenhall fits that bill. Also, the Bears lost Berrian and Muhhamed at WR--desperate there, especially if they expect better results from the dynamic duo at QB (Grossman/Orton). Having said that, I don't hate the pick, but I would have gone with Malcom Kelly or maybe Talib. |
